bookmark via un controle calendrier
Le
macgiver
bonjour, j'ai un controle calendrier dans mon formulaire qui inscrit la date
dans ma table, je me suis mis une condition pour pas que la date ne se répète
2 fois (jusque là tout va bien). Je voudrais être capable, lorsque l'usager
entre une date déja présente dans ma table, que mon formulaire pointe sur
cette date, le meme principe que ce cette procédure qui fonctionne
parfaitement avec une liste déroulante sur l'événement after update.
Dim rs As Object
Set rs = Me.Recordset.Clone
rs.FindFirst "[cle] = " & Str(Me![Modifiable13])
Me.Bookmark = rs.Bookmark
Donc mon problème c'est que ce n'est pas une liste déroulante mais bien un
controle calendar. comment m'y prendre??? Merci
dans ma table, je me suis mis une condition pour pas que la date ne se répète
2 fois (jusque là tout va bien). Je voudrais être capable, lorsque l'usager
entre une date déja présente dans ma table, que mon formulaire pointe sur
cette date, le meme principe que ce cette procédure qui fonctionne
parfaitement avec une liste déroulante sur l'événement after update.
Dim rs As Object
Set rs = Me.Recordset.Clone
rs.FindFirst "[cle] = " & Str(Me![Modifiable13])
Me.Bookmark = rs.Bookmark
Donc mon problème c'est que ce n'est pas une liste déroulante mais bien un
controle calendar. comment m'y prendre??? Merci

Poser une question


tu fais exactement pareil.
exemple:
Dim rs As Object
Set rs = Me.Recordset.Clone
rs.FindFirst "[Madate] = #" & Format(Me![Madate], "mm/dd/yyyy") & "#"
If Not rs.EOF Then
' ici une date trouvée
Me.Bookmark = rs.Bookmark
Else
' ici pas de date trouvée.
End If
--
@+
Raymond Access MVP
http://OfficeSystem.Access.free.fr/
http://www.mpfa.info/ pour débuter sur le forum.
Inscrivez-vous à la Newsletter TechNet.
http://www.microsoft.com/france/tec...fault.mspx
"macgiver" news:
| bonjour, j'ai un controle calendrier dans mon formulaire qui inscrit la
date
| dans ma table, je me suis mis une condition pour pas que la date ne se
répète
| 2 fois (jusque là tout va bien). Je voudrais être capable, lorsque
l'usager
| entre une date déja présente dans ma table, que mon formulaire pointe sur
| cette date, le meme principe que ce cette procédure qui fonctionne
| parfaitement avec une liste déroulante sur l'événement after update.
|
| Dim rs As Object
| Set rs = Me.Recordset.Clone
| rs.FindFirst "[cle] = " & Str(Me![Modifiable13])
| Me.Bookmark = rs.Bookmark
|
| Donc mon problème c'est que ce n'est pas une liste déroulante mais bien un
| controle calendar. comment m'y prendre??? Merci
a+